§ 101A.104. PUBLIC INFORMATION ON COST OF LONG-TERM CARE.

Official statutory text

The department shall develop programs to provide information to the public relating to:

(1) the cost of long-term care;

(2) the limits on Medicaid eligibility;

(3) the adequacy or inadequacy of other financing options, including Medicare; and

(4) possible methods of financing long-term care, including group insurance policies and other methods designed to assist individuals.
